First Day of School in Jefferson Parish is August 8
The first day of school for students in grades 1-12 is Thursday, August 8 in Jefferson Parish Schools. Students in kindergarten and pre-K start August 15 or 16. That date varies by school.

Jefferson Parish Schools is the largest and most diverse public school system in Louisiana and the 98th largest in the nation. Our system of 82 schools serves around 50,000 students on both banks of the Mississippi River. With approximately 7,000 employees, JP Schools is one of the largest employers in Jefferson Parish.
